Merge tag 'mlx5-fixes-2017-06-14' of git://git.kernel.org/pub/scm/linux/kernel/git/saeed/linux



Saeed Mahameed says:

====================
Mellanox mlx5 fixes 2017-06-14

This series contains some fixes for the mlx5 core and netdev driver.

Please pull and let me know if there's any problem.

For -stable:
("net/mlx5: Wait for FW readiness before initializing command interface") kernels >= 4.4
("net/mlx5e: Fix timestamping capabilities reporting") kernels >= 4.5
("net/mlx5e: Avoid doing a cleanup call if the profile doesn't have it") kernels >= 4.9
("net/mlx5e: Fix min inline value for VF rep SQs") kernels >= 4.11

The "net/mlx5e: Fix min inline .." (a oneliner patch) doesn't cleanly apply
to 4.11, it hits a contextual conflict and can be easily resolved by:
+       mlx5_query_min_inline(mdev, &priv->params.tx_min_inline_mode);
to the end of mlx5e_build_rep_netdev_priv. Note the 2nd parameter of
mlx5_query_min_inline is slightly different from the original one.
